Timmy Dooley (Clare, Fianna Fail) | Oireachtas source
To understand the reason confidence in this Government has fallen so dramatically since it received one of the biggest mandates in the history of the State, we need only contrast the commitments made prior to March 2011 by both the Fine Gael Party and Labour Party with the actions of those parties in Government in the period since then. The so-called democratic revolution has given way to democratic revulsion as to how the Government conducts its business.
In the three years and nine months since the Government took office, we have witnessed some significant achievements. The economic recovery of recent months is extremely welcome in a country that has endured six financially difficult years.
